| /GUIX-v6.2.1/common/src/ |
| D | gx_single_line_text_input_draw_position_get.c | 86 GX_VALUE x_pos; in _gx_single_line_text_input_draw_position_get() local 126 x_pos = (GX_VALUE)(client.gx_rectangle_right - 1); in _gx_single_line_text_input_draw_position_get() 128 x_pos = (GX_VALUE)(x_pos - text_input -> gx_single_line_text_input_xoffset); in _gx_single_line_text_input_draw_position_get() 141 else if (x_pos > client.gx_rectangle_left + 1) in _gx_single_line_text_input_draw_position_get() 149 x_pos = (GX_VALUE)(client.gx_rectangle_right - 1); in _gx_single_line_text_input_draw_position_get() 153 x_pos = (GX_VALUE)(client.gx_rectangle_left + 1 + (client_width >> 1)); in _gx_single_line_text_input_draw_position_get() 154 x_pos = (GX_VALUE)(x_pos - text_input -> gx_single_line_text_input_xoffset); in _gx_single_line_text_input_draw_position_get() 167 else if ((x_pos > client.gx_rectangle_left + 1) || in _gx_single_line_text_input_draw_position_get() 168 (x_pos + text_width < client.gx_rectangle_right - 1)) in _gx_single_line_text_input_draw_position_get() 175 x_pos = (GX_VALUE)(client.gx_rectangle_left + 1 + (client_width >> 1)); in _gx_single_line_text_input_draw_position_get() [all …]
|
| D | gx_single_line_text_input_character_delete.c | 96 GX_VALUE x_pos; in _gx_single_line_text_input_character_delete() local 156 x_pos = (GX_VALUE)(client.gx_rectangle_right - 1); in _gx_single_line_text_input_character_delete() 157 x_pos = (GX_VALUE)(x_pos - text_input -> gx_single_line_text_input_xoffset); in _gx_single_line_text_input_character_delete() 159 if (x_pos + text_width > client.gx_rectangle_right - 1) in _gx_single_line_text_input_character_delete() 161 … offset = (GX_VALUE)((x_pos + text_width - del_char_width) - (client.gx_rectangle_right - 1)); in _gx_single_line_text_input_character_delete() 179 x_pos = (GX_VALUE)(client.gx_rectangle_left + 1); in _gx_single_line_text_input_character_delete() 180 … x_pos = (GX_VALUE)(x_pos + ((client.gx_rectangle_right - client.gx_rectangle_left + 1) >> 1)); in _gx_single_line_text_input_character_delete() 181 x_pos = (GX_VALUE)(x_pos - text_input -> gx_single_line_text_input_xoffset); in _gx_single_line_text_input_character_delete() 184 …dirty_area.gx_rectangle_left = (GX_VALUE)(x_pos - (cursor_ptr -> gx_text_input_cursor_width >> 1)); in _gx_single_line_text_input_character_delete() 185 …dirty_area.gx_rectangle_right = (GX_VALUE)(x_pos + text_width + ((cursor_ptr -> gx_text_input_curs… in _gx_single_line_text_input_character_delete() [all …]
|
| D | gx_single_line_text_input_backspace.c | 91 GX_VALUE x_pos; in _gx_single_line_text_input_backspace() local 166 x_pos = (GX_VALUE)(client.gx_rectangle_right - 1); in _gx_single_line_text_input_backspace() 167 x_pos = (GX_VALUE)(x_pos - text_input -> gx_single_line_text_input_xoffset); in _gx_single_line_text_input_backspace() 169 leftoff = (GX_VALUE)(client.gx_rectangle_left + 1 - x_pos); in _gx_single_line_text_input_backspace() 170 rightoff = (GX_VALUE)(x_pos + text_width - (client.gx_rectangle_right - 1)); in _gx_single_line_text_input_backspace() 210 x_pos = (GX_VALUE)(client.gx_rectangle_left + 1); in _gx_single_line_text_input_backspace() 211 … x_pos = (GX_VALUE)(x_pos + ((client.gx_rectangle_right - client.gx_rectangle_left + 1) >> 1)); in _gx_single_line_text_input_backspace() 212 x_pos = (GX_VALUE)(x_pos - text_input -> gx_single_line_text_input_xoffset); in _gx_single_line_text_input_backspace() 220 … client.gx_rectangle_left = (GX_VALUE)(x_pos - (cursor_ptr -> gx_text_input_cursor_width >> 1)); in _gx_single_line_text_input_backspace() 221 …client.gx_rectangle_right = (GX_VALUE)(x_pos + text_width + ((cursor_ptr -> gx_text_input_cursor_w… in _gx_single_line_text_input_backspace() [all …]
|
| D | gx_widget_text_blend.c | 165 GX_VALUE x_pos; in _gx_widget_text_blend_ext() local 189 x_pos = widget -> gx_widget_size.gx_rectangle_left; in _gx_widget_text_blend_ext() 198 x_pos = (GX_VALUE)(x_pos + widget_width - 1); in _gx_widget_text_blend_ext() 199 x_pos = (GX_VALUE)(x_pos - text_width - border_width); in _gx_widget_text_blend_ext() 203 x_pos = (GX_VALUE)(x_pos + border_width); in _gx_widget_text_blend_ext() 210 x_pos = (GX_VALUE)(x_pos + ((widget_width - text_width) / 2)); in _gx_widget_text_blend_ext() 215 … _gx_canvas_text_draw_ext((GX_VALUE)(x_pos + x_offset), (GX_VALUE)(y_pos + y_offset), string); in _gx_widget_text_blend_ext()
|
| D | gx_widget_text_draw.c | 162 GX_VALUE x_pos; in _gx_widget_text_draw_ext() local 185 x_pos = widget -> gx_widget_size.gx_rectangle_left; in _gx_widget_text_draw_ext() 194 x_pos = (GX_VALUE)(x_pos + widget_width - 1); in _gx_widget_text_draw_ext() 195 x_pos = (GX_VALUE)(x_pos - text_width - border_width); in _gx_widget_text_draw_ext() 199 x_pos = (GX_VALUE)(x_pos + border_width); in _gx_widget_text_draw_ext() 206 x_pos = (GX_VALUE)(x_pos + ((widget_width - text_width) / 2)); in _gx_widget_text_draw_ext() 211 … _gx_canvas_text_draw_ext((GX_VALUE)(x_pos + x_offset), (GX_VALUE)(y_pos + y_offset), string); in _gx_widget_text_draw_ext()
|
| D | gx_single_line_text_input_position_update.c | 83 GX_VALUE x_pos; in _gx_single_line_text_input_position_update() local 101 x_pos = (GX_VALUE)(client.gx_rectangle_right - 1); in _gx_single_line_text_input_position_update() 105 x_pos = client.gx_rectangle_left; in _gx_single_line_text_input_position_update() 106 … x_pos = (GX_VALUE)(x_pos + 1 + ((client.gx_rectangle_right - client.gx_rectangle_left + 1) >> 1)); in _gx_single_line_text_input_position_update() 111 x_pos = (GX_VALUE)(client.gx_rectangle_left + 1); in _gx_single_line_text_input_position_update() 116 x_pos = (GX_VALUE)(x_pos - text_input -> gx_single_line_text_input_xoffset); in _gx_single_line_text_input_position_update() 119 cursor_ptr -> gx_text_input_cursor_pos.gx_point_x = (GX_VALUE)(x_pos + width); in _gx_single_line_text_input_position_update()
|
| D | gx_single_line_text_input_draw.c | 105 GX_VALUE x_pos; in _gx_single_line_text_input_draw() local 142 status = _gx_single_line_text_input_draw_position_get(text_input, &x_pos, &y_pos); in _gx_single_line_text_input_draw() 186 _gx_canvas_text_draw_ext(x_pos, y_pos, &string); in _gx_single_line_text_input_draw() 203 _gx_canvas_text_draw_ext(x_pos, y_pos, &string); in _gx_single_line_text_input_draw() 204 x_pos = (GX_VALUE)(x_pos + text_width); in _gx_single_line_text_input_draw() 223 client.gx_rectangle_left = x_pos; in _gx_single_line_text_input_draw() 224 client.gx_rectangle_right = (GX_VALUE)(x_pos + text_width - 1); in _gx_single_line_text_input_draw() 229 _gx_canvas_text_draw_ext(x_pos, y_pos, &string); in _gx_single_line_text_input_draw() 230 x_pos = (GX_VALUE)(x_pos + text_width); in _gx_single_line_text_input_draw() 239 _gx_canvas_text_draw_ext(x_pos, y_pos, &string); in _gx_single_line_text_input_draw()
|
| D | gx_multi_line_text_input_draw.c | 96 INT x_pos; in _gx_multi_line_text_input_draw() local 267 x_pos = client.gx_rectangle_right - 1; in _gx_multi_line_text_input_draw() 268 x_pos = (GX_VALUE)(x_pos - text_width); in _gx_multi_line_text_input_draw() 271 x_pos = client.gx_rectangle_left + 1; in _gx_multi_line_text_input_draw() 285 … x_pos = (GX_VALUE)(client.gx_rectangle_left + ((client_width - text_width) / 2)); in _gx_multi_line_text_input_draw() 303 … _gx_canvas_text_draw_ext((GX_VALUE)x_pos, (GX_VALUE)y_pos, &draw_string); in _gx_multi_line_text_input_draw() 304 x_pos += text_width; in _gx_multi_line_text_input_draw() 324 draw_area.gx_rectangle_left = (GX_VALUE)x_pos; in _gx_multi_line_text_input_draw() 325 draw_area.gx_rectangle_right = (GX_VALUE)(x_pos + text_width - 1); in _gx_multi_line_text_input_draw() 338 _gx_canvas_text_draw_ext((GX_VALUE)x_pos, (GX_VALUE)y_pos, &draw_string); in _gx_multi_line_text_input_draw() [all …]
|
| D | gx_single_line_text_input_position_get.c | 93 GX_VALUE x_pos; in _gx_single_line_text_input_position_get() local 116 x_pos = (GX_VALUE)(client.gx_rectangle_right - 1); in _gx_single_line_text_input_position_get() 120 …x_pos = (GX_VALUE)(client.gx_rectangle_left + 1 + ((client.gx_rectangle_right - client.gx_rectangl… in _gx_single_line_text_input_position_get() 125 x_pos = (GX_VALUE)(client.gx_rectangle_left + 1); in _gx_single_line_text_input_position_get() 129 x_pos = (GX_VALUE)(x_pos - text_input -> gx_single_line_text_input_xoffset); in _gx_single_line_text_input_position_get() 142 if (pixel_position > x_pos) in _gx_single_line_text_input_position_get() 144 distance = (GX_VALUE)(pixel_position - x_pos); in _gx_single_line_text_input_position_get() 179 cursor_pos = (GX_VALUE)(x_pos + cursor_pos); in _gx_single_line_text_input_position_get()
|
| D | gx_canvas_rotated_text_draw.c | 159 INT x_pos; in _gx_canvas_rotated_text_draw_ext() local 192 x_pos = xcenter - (alphamap_width / 2); in _gx_canvas_rotated_text_draw_ext() 195 _gx_canvas_text_draw_ext((GX_VALUE)x_pos, (GX_VALUE)y_pos, text); in _gx_canvas_rotated_text_draw_ext() 202 x_pos = y_pos = 0; in _gx_canvas_rotated_text_draw_ext() 204 … if (_gx_utility_pixelmap_rotate(&textmap, angle, &rotated_map, &x_pos, &y_pos) == GX_SUCCESS) in _gx_canvas_rotated_text_draw_ext() 206 x_pos = xcenter - (rotated_map.gx_pixelmap_width / 2); in _gx_canvas_rotated_text_draw_ext() 213 _gx_canvas_pixelmap_draw((GX_VALUE)x_pos, (GX_VALUE)y_pos, &rotated_map); in _gx_canvas_rotated_text_draw_ext()
|
| D | gx_canvas_text_draw.c | 337 GX_VALUE x_pos; in _gx_canvas_aligned_text_draw() local 355 x_pos = rectangle -> gx_rectangle_left; in _gx_canvas_aligned_text_draw() 363 x_pos = (GX_VALUE)(x_pos + rect_width - 1); in _gx_canvas_aligned_text_draw() 364 x_pos = (GX_VALUE)(x_pos - text_width); in _gx_canvas_aligned_text_draw() 372 x_pos = (GX_VALUE)(x_pos + ((rect_width - text_width) / 2)); in _gx_canvas_aligned_text_draw() 377 return _gx_canvas_text_draw_ext(x_pos, y_pos, string); in _gx_canvas_aligned_text_draw()
|
| D | gx_text_scroll_wheel_draw.c | 99 … GX_CONST GX_STRING *string, GX_VALUE x_pos, GX_VALUE y_pos, GX_VALUE width, GX_VALUE height) in _gx_text_scroll_wheel_round_text_draw() argument 139 x_pos = (GX_VALUE)(x_pos + width - 1); in _gx_text_scroll_wheel_round_text_draw() 140 x_pos = (GX_VALUE)(x_pos - text_width); in _gx_text_scroll_wheel_round_text_draw() 148 x_pos = (GX_VALUE)(x_pos + ((width - text_width) / 2)); in _gx_text_scroll_wheel_round_text_draw() 165 _gx_canvas_pixelmap_draw(x_pos, y_pos, &resized_map); in _gx_text_scroll_wheel_round_text_draw() 234 … GX_CONST GX_STRING *string, GX_VALUE x_pos, GX_VALUE y_pos, GX_VALUE width, GX_VALUE height) in _gx_text_scroll_wheel_flat_text_draw() argument 257 x_pos = (GX_VALUE)(x_pos + width - 1); in _gx_text_scroll_wheel_flat_text_draw() 258 x_pos = (GX_VALUE)(x_pos - text_width); in _gx_text_scroll_wheel_flat_text_draw() 266 x_pos = (GX_VALUE)(x_pos + ((width - text_width) / 2)); in _gx_text_scroll_wheel_flat_text_draw() 271 _gx_canvas_text_draw_ext(x_pos, y_pos, string); in _gx_text_scroll_wheel_flat_text_draw() [all …]
|
| D | gx_multi_line_text_view_text_draw.c | 112 INT x_pos; in _gx_multi_line_text_view_text_draw() local 297 x_pos = client.gx_rectangle_right - 1; in _gx_multi_line_text_view_text_draw() 298 x_pos = (GX_VALUE)(x_pos - text_width); in _gx_multi_line_text_view_text_draw() 301 x_pos = client.gx_rectangle_left + 1; in _gx_multi_line_text_view_text_draw() 311 x_pos = (GX_VALUE)(client.gx_rectangle_left + ((client_width - text_width) / 2)); in _gx_multi_line_text_view_text_draw() 316 _gx_canvas_text_draw_ext((GX_VALUE)x_pos, (GX_VALUE)y_pos, &line_string); in _gx_multi_line_text_view_text_draw()
|
| D | gx_line_chart_data_draw.c | 77 INT x_pos; in _gx_line_chart_data_draw() local 125 x_pos = last_x_pos + x_step; in _gx_line_chart_data_draw() 127 (GX_VALUE)(GX_FIXED_VAL_TO_INT(x_pos)), (GX_VALUE)y_pos); in _gx_line_chart_data_draw() 128 last_x_pos = x_pos; in _gx_line_chart_data_draw()
|
| /GUIX-v6.2.1/test/guix_test/regression_test/tests/ |
| D | validation_guix_drop_list_24xrgb.c | 70 int x_pos; in control_thread_entry() local 83 x_pos = drop_list->gx_widget_size.gx_rectangle_left + 10; in control_thread_entry() 108 my_event.gx_event_payload.gx_event_pointdata.gx_point_x = x_pos; in control_thread_entry() 116 sprintf(test_comment, "click on point(%d, %d) to select an item", x_pos, y_pos); in control_thread_entry()
|
| /GUIX-v6.2.1/samples/demo_guix_widget_types/ |
| D | demo_guix_widget_types.c | 643 GX_VALUE x_pos, y_pos; in custom_next_button_draw() local 647 x_pos = pixelmap_button->gx_widget_size.gx_rectangle_left; in custom_next_button_draw() 652 x_pos += 2; in custom_next_button_draw() 658 gx_canvas_pixelmap_draw(x_pos, y_pos, map); in custom_next_button_draw()
|